Abstract
It has demonstrated that an externally applied electric field perturbs the distribution of some of the macromolecules in biological membranes. Various electrostatic, hydrodynamic and structural forces resulting from the external field influence the movement of intramembraneous particles. This study investigates one of those forces, that due to the polarization of the ion distribution is calculated at any point on the cell surface.
